A project for analyzing server logs (Apache/Nginx) using Pandas to detect hacking attempts and traffic anomalies.
- SQL Injection: Detecting SQL injection attempts
- XSS attacks: identifying cross-site scripting
- Path Traversal: detecting file system access attempts
- Command Injection: command injection detection
- Brute Force: detection of password guessing attacks
- Scan: Vulnerability Scan Detection
- Access to Admin Panels: Monitoring attempts to access administrative resources
- Traffic Bursts: Detecting Abnormal Request Peak
- DDoS Attacks: Identifying Potential Denial of Service Attacks
- Bot Traffic: Definition of Automated Traffic
- Pattern Analysis: Hourly and Daily Traffic Patterns
- Status Codes: Distribution of HTTP response codes

The system calculates the following metrics:
- Risk Score: Risk score for IP addresses (0-100)
- Error Rate: Error rate for each IP
- Attack Severity: Severity of detected attacks
- Traffic Anomalies: Traffic anomalies
